W8LDO wrote:
Fri Mar 04, 2022 8:19 pm
Anybody else having problems with receive? About one out of every 25 to 50 recieve transmissions are quiet. I can do a channel up and down or down and up, after I notice, and I will begin to hear it again. Do I have something set wrong?
I have found the fix for this. Change the TX Delay in the pi-star settings from 100 to 0 for the modem.

Anybody else having problems with receive? About one out of every 25 to 50 recieve transmissions are quiet. I can do a channel up and down or down and up, after I notice, and I will begin to hear it again. Do I have something set wrong?
I have found the fix for this. Change the TX Delay in the pi-star settings from 100 to 0 for the modem.
Personally, in ''Modem'', I configured my ''TXDelay'' at 50 (originally at 100) since it is thus compatible with all of my radios. The ''DMRDelay'' is at 0 and has not been modified.
For the rest, you have to do a calibration procedure.

any reason for choosing 50 over 0? i haven't had any problems with the 0 setting yet. Is there anything you run into by setting it less than 50?

I had some problems at 10 so I didn't go all the way to 0. But it depends on the type of HotSpot you have.
For example, my config are not the same on a Chinese JumboSpot as with a duplex Lonestar.
In addition, with some radios, such as Anytone, some hotspot must make a particular configuration so that it responds well...
